mysql mybatis 日期查詢
<select id="selectInParamRecord" parameterType="map" resultType="com.thinkgem.jeesite.modules.ada.entity.ParamRecordDto"> SELECT serial_num AS serialNum, creat_time AS createDate FROM t_gl_adapter_param_input WHERE service_type = ‘${insertIn.serviceType}‘ <if test="insertIn.createDate != null and insertIn.createDate != ‘‘"> <![CDATA[ and DATE_FORMAT(creat_time, ‘%Y-%m-%d‘)>=DATE_FORMAT(#{insertIn.createDate}, ‘%Y-%m-%d‘) ]]> </if> </select>
mysql mybatis 日期查詢
相關推薦
mysql mybatis 日期查詢
modules 查詢 mybatis 日期 mat sel %d amr ted <select id="selectInParamRecord" parameterType="map" resultType="com.thinkgem.jeesite.mod
mybatis 日期查詢datetime
str csdn data exceptio cda order %d sta desc <select id="getHistoryDataByDate" parameterType="java.util.HashMap" resultType="java.ut
【關於MySQL查詢日期區間的隱藏問題】MySQL根據日期查詢資料不對
問題描述: 假設一個表中有如下資料: 查詢2018-08-17到2018-08-19的資料,正確答案顯而易見是5條 但如果使用下面兩個sql語句,你會看到不同的結果: 第一種:SELECT * from date_test WHERE test_date >= '
mysql通過日期查詢 sq語句
今天 select * from 表名 where to_days(時間欄位名) = to_days(now()); 昨天 SELECT * FROM 表名 WHERE TO_DAYS( NOW( ) ) - TO_DAYS( 時間欄位名) <= 1 7天
mysql根據日期查詢資料
資料庫中時間欄位是mytime,date型別: //查詢當天的資料 @Select("select * from table where DATE_FORMAT(mytime,'%Y-%m-%d') = DATE_FORMAT(NOW(), '%Y-%m-%d') ")
mybatis日期查詢
一、專案需求 需求先了解 選擇時間間隔 - 點選’查詢按鈕’查詢資料 - 用echarts視覺化資料。 草圖說邏輯 先用一張草圖來說明本篇文章的邏輯 注:本篇部落格只討論,mybatis查詢資料技術,如你想了解相關技術
2019-01-09T12:38:17.000+08:00(oracle+mybatis日期查詢處理)
時區 ati nbsp main domain .com form img bsp 使用mybatis讀取 oracle的date時間類型,查詢結果類型為2019-01-09T12:38:17.000+08:00 在javaBean(domain)的屬性get
Mysql-常用日期查詢
開發十年,就只剩下這套架構體系了! >>>
mysql按日期分組(group by)查詢統計的時候,沒有數據補0的解決辦法
details map對象 有一個 end creat 對象 結果 插入 數據返回 轉載自:http://blog.csdn.net/jie11447416/article/details/50887888 1、案例中的數據結構和數據如下 2、在沒有解決的時候,是這樣的
簡單按日期查詢mysql某張表中的記錄數
unsigned 計劃 表結構 記錄 create sig 站點 signed using 測試表表結構:mysql> show create table dr_stats\G 1. row Table: dr_stats Create Table:
mysql根據時間查詢日期的優化
tween 根據 pre reg _for format datetime 變量 結束 例如查詢昨日新註冊用戶,寫法有如下兩種: EXPLAIN select * from chess_user u where DATE_FORMAT(u.register_time,‘
MySQL常用日期函式,日期相減,按天、周、月查詢
MySQL日期函式 select now(); -- 獲取當前時間 select DAYOFWEEK(now()); -- -- 1=星期天,2=星期一,3星期二,... select WEEKDAY(now()); -- --0=星期一,1星期二,... select DAYOFMO
Mysql常見的日期查詢語句
需要注意點的是,MySql查詢某區間日期時是按照00:00:00來的,也就是如果查詢4月1號到4月4號的資料,後面要寫成xxxx-04-05 查詢往前7天的資料: select * from 資料表 where DATE_SUB(CURDATE(), INTERVAL 7 DAY) &l
SqlServer中的date日期在mybatis中查詢出來差兩天
在使用mybatis查詢所有的資料的時候,我發現個問題,實體類中的欄位是String ,資料中的欄位是date,然後再mybatis中查詢出來的日期之後,總是比資料庫中的天數少兩天, 找了很多地方 終於找到了 解決方案如下 解決方案一 將資料型別從date轉換成datetime,
mysql-mybatis 儲存過程-分頁查詢
1.建立表 CREATE TABLE EASYBUY_PRODUCT( `ep_id` INTEGER NOT NULL PRIMARY KEY AUTO_INCREMENT COMMENT '自動編號(標識列),主鍵', `ep_name`
記錄一個mysql按日期分組統計的查詢
SELECT DATE_FORMAT( deteline, "%Y-%m-%d %H" ) , COUNT( * ) FROM testGROUP BY DATE_FORMAT( deteline, "%Y-%m-%d %H" ) 查詢某天: deteline, "%Y
mysql按日期分組(group by)查詢統計的時候,沒有資料補0的解決辦法
寫部落格真實個費時費力的差事,好佩服那些部落格閱讀幾十上百萬的人。今天研究了半天按照日期分組統計,沒有資料就為空了,我要讓他顯示0呀。想了辦法,都沒有找到一個好的,解決方案,然後用了一個很low的方法實現了,還是把它記錄下來。方法是用於MySQL,與開發語言無關。 1、案例中的資料結構和資料如下 2、
mysql按日期分組(group by)查詢統計的時候,沒有資料補0的解決辦法。
寫部落格真實個費時費力的差事,好佩服那些部落格閱讀幾十上百萬的人。今天研究了半天按照日期分組統計,沒有資料就為空了,我要讓他顯示0呀。想了辦法,都沒有找到一個好的,解決方案,然後用了一個很low的
mysql 指定日期格式查詢
mysql> select date_format(DATE_SUB(CURDATE(), INTERVAL 7 DAY),’%y%m%d’); +———————————————————–+ | date_format(DATE_SUB(CURDATE(), INTERVAL 7 DAY),’%y%
mysql between and 遇到日期查詢邊界問題
最近實現一個按日期範圍查詢列表,例如輸入的是日期 2015-11-01到2015-11-03,想得到1號到3號的資料, 執行 select * from table where create_date between '2015-11-01' and '2015-11-03